Output 26ab5ac10520b43e2dfb8c05155ebb06ed1f651d53382aa7bc24318dce31c589:1
- value
- 530742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8112f39513553fe38fd662e6e7871e8160ef57d2 OP_EQUAL
- address
- 3DTVo4bGh8kzVdM4LhrfHRjBqvKGAHoS3N
- transaction
- 26ab5ac10520b43e2dfb8c05155ebb06ed1f651d53382aa7bc24318dce31c589